About this listen
Falling for my childhood sweetheart wasn’t part of the plan.
Moving back to Heather Bay wasn’t on Oliver’s agenda for the summer, but after inheriting a cottage in dire need of renovation, he doesn’t have much choice. Supervising the builders should be easy…except the man in charge is Oliver’s childhood best friend and ex-boyfriend.
Lane’s spent nine years desperately trying to forget his first love, but that doesn’t stop him from fantasizing about Oliver in every spare moment once he discovers Oliver’s back in town. Falling into bed together isn’t supposed to mean anything, even if Lane’s emotions feel too big to be ignored.
Being drawn to each other is one thing, but being stuck together after disaster strikes the renovations is another. The pull of the past is strong, but Oliver and Lane have been down this road before. This time they’ll need to learn from their mistakes so they can finally keep their promises.
Like I Promised is a steamy second-chance contemporary MM romance featuring former childhood sweethearts, interfering friends, questionable barbecues, a very lazy Collie, cozy coffee shops, and secret beaches.

Cozy second chance romance!
Like I Promised was a second chance low angst story about Oliver, an editor, who inherits his grandmother's home, and his ex high school sweetheart, Lane, who is hired to fix up the house.
I love a second chance romance and this story really reminded me of that. I love the casual queerness of this story, and how it was both about these two and their love story, but also about this group of queer friends that Oliver joins with the help of Lane. This town was so queer and it was beautiful to read. I loved all this game nights and gatherings they had as a group.
These two reconnect pretty quickly in this book but it felt realistic to me because they were high school sweethearts and you could feel how much these two knew each other. It felt like they were picking up where they left off and that they fell into Something together again easily.
When the two start to take this as a less temporary thing and want more, Oliver is really struggling with deciding if he wants to continue his life in London or move back and try again with Lane. And Lane is trying to decide if him wanting to ask Oliver to stay is just like when they were younger and him still wanting Oliver to spread his wings. These two were so considerate of one anothers feelings and not at the expensive of their own; there wasn't a lot of self loathing with these two, they just had huge life decisions to make and wanted each other to be happy.
Over I think this story was so cozy and gave me hope for small towns and reminded me why I love queer friend groups.

Love the team of Charlie and Dan!!
Another amazing listen from Charlie Novak and Dan Calley!
This is the story of Oliver and Lane; a second chance romance between two men that never got over each other.
Lane and Oliver were childhood friends growing up in Heather Bay, and as they grew older their feelings turned to attraction, then love. They both thought this was it for them, but when Oliver gets into university and Lane wants to stay to work for his father, things quickly go south for these two.
Then nine years later, Oliver is brought back to Heather Bay when he inherits a cottage, and his mother has already hired a contractor to fix it up. Then he is face to face with his lost love again.
Oliver and Lane are super sweet together (they are also dead sexy together!). They always loved each other but were both hurt in the past, but their reunion is absolutely lovely.
Dan Calley does an amazing job narrating as always!!

Love this sweet second chance romance!
Oliver and Lane are just...ugh! I love these two so much together and while the angst leading up to them sorting out their stuff was kinda brutal, I loved seeing them finally happy together! Lane's deep love of his sweet little seaside town was so enduring and I loved that he didn't make excuses for not wanting to leave his home for something bigger and better. Oliver was tense and guarded at the beginning but I loved seeing him open up not only to Lane but also to what he truly wanted out of life, rather than what was "expected" of him to pursue. Second chance romances are so painful in many ways but I loved seeing how Lane and Oliver were able to address those issues that drove them apart in the first place without completely destroying the new relationship they were building. The ending was magical and getting to see a little glimpse of their happy lives together was amazing. The group of friends they have collected is so dynamic and diverse and seem like the kind of friends who will not only tease you until you want to explode but also be there at 3am when you need them. It was sweet to see them all together and building a family together. With so many interesting side characters, I hope there are a lot of future HEA set in Heather Bay! Wonderful writing with just the best characters! As for the narration, Dan Calley has quick become a top narrator for me! I love the timber of his voice and his ability to bring so many different characters to life within a story. I hope Dan will continue to narrate Charlie's book because they are an absolute joy to listen to!
